Perform preventative maintenance, repairs and diagnostics of electronic components, power train management controls, climate controls and other on-board controls on Mesa County’s fleet of vehicles, heavy equipment and specialized machinery. Job requirements will include installation of specialized accessory equipment, such as two-way radios, cell phones, lap tops and modems and miscellaneous law enforcement equipment. Required skills will also include some welding and fabricating and other general duties as assigned. This position may require that the employee work alone, unsupervised on field repair assignments at times.

Perform all levels of preventative maintenance on Mesa County’s fleet of heavy equipment, light automotive vehicles, light and medium duty trucks, transit buses, specialized seasonal equipment and machinery including some landfill equipment. Job functions will also include, but not be limited to, diagnostics and repairs of gasoline and diesel engines, power train components, hydraulic systems, A/C systems, hydraulic and air brake systems, complex electrical and electronic systems and other components which may not be listed. Job functions will also include welding and fabricating skills and experience.Job functions will include the knowledge, experience and skills to be able to read and follow technical instructions and diagnostic flow charts and to skillfully use diagnostic scan tools, analyzers, digital volt/ohm meters, A/C recovery and charge stations, and other fluid recycler/recovery machines. Job functions will also include the use of vehicle and equipment high lifts and other specialty shop tools specific to maintenance and repair activities such as tire changing machines and welding and metal cutting tools and equipment.Job functions will include repair and maintenance of shop equipment, and cleaning and detailing of vehicles and equipment, as assigned.Must be able to use a desktop, laptop or tablet based terminal to log labor time and repair notes and data to electronic work orders.Performs federal DOT-mandated safety inspections and certifies vehicle safety.Job functions may at times also include field work where some repair and maintenance activities will be performed in the field (away from shop facility) with a field equipped service truck and without direct supervision.Experienced employees may assume lead worker responsibilities, especially in the absence of direct supervision.Oral and written communications must be clear and effective.Performs other related duties as assigned.Minimum Requirements:M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S REQUIRED:Education and Experience:High school education or GED with one (1) year vocational/technical school training specific to heavy equipment and automotive repair and maintenance and three (3) years of progressively responsible related work experience.Any combination of education, training and experience which provides the knowledge, skills and abilities required for the job.Licenses and Certifications:Class “A” or “B” Colorado Commercial Driver's License - Tanker EndorsementMAC’s or Comparable Air Conditioning (R-134a) Certification (desired)Department of Transportation Safety Inspector Certification (or regulatory experience requirements)A.S.E. Certifications - (desired)Supplemental Information:P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S AND WORKING ENVIRONMENT:This position requires standing, stooping, sitting, bending, twisting, and lifting up to 100 pounds.Work is done typically indoors but may occasionally be exposed to outside atmospheric conditions for moderate periods of time and must continue work even during inclement conditions.The employee is frequently exposed to dirt, smoke, fumes, extreme heat and cold for long duration, outside atmospheric conditions, traffic noise, and dust for sustained periods of time.The employee is frequently exposed to possible bodily injury from moving mechanical parts of equipment, tools, and machinery.The employee is occasionally exposed to possible bodily injury from electrical shock, falling from high places, and toxic or caustic chemicals.While performing the essential functions of this job, shaking objects or surfaces; conditions such as fumes, noxious odors, mists, gases, and poor ventilation that affect the respiratory system eyes, or the skin.Typical noise level of work environment is loud, primarily from engines, equipment, machinery, and power tools.
